What Nemesio Means

Of Greek origin, derived from 'Nemesis', the goddess of divine retribution and vengeance. It can also mean 'righteous anger'.

The Story of Nemesio

He carries a name from antiquity, a symbol of righteousness and the strength to stand for what is due.

Of Greek origin, Nemesio is derived from 'Nemesis,' the goddess of divine retribution and balance. It speaks to a profound sense of justice, often interpreted as 'righteous anger' or the rightful giving of what is owed.
